    Unfortunate Statement.

    Suarez comes out straightaway and apologises to all and sundry: player, club, football, population, ...
    Yet for that statement he gets an extra 7 matches according to the panel report. Why? Because in that statement he also said he only deserved 3 matches. The panel concluded that he did not appreciate the seriousness of his act.

    Who the **** in the comms department wrote that statement ( can't be Suarez as he is illiterate )? Without that sentence, the panel would have given him 4-6 matches.
